How to get out Haman


How to get out Haman

Haman Bus Terminal is the easiest way to reach other cities from there you can take a bus to adjacent Masan (Nam Masan Terminal in Shin Masan and Masan Intercity Bus Terminal) and there are a number of buses to Uiryeong-gun to the west. There are also buses that go to Busan starting at 7:30 AM and ending at 8:00 PM. They leave every hour and a half. If you want to travel to Jinju and other surrounding counties, you can take the train going in the direction of Suncheon, Jeollnam-do and Busan. However, it's probably much easier to just go to Masan and take a bus onward from there. Bus Fare Masan (Masan Intercity Bus Terminal) - 1600 Won (Every 30-40 minutes) Masan (Shin Masan - Nambu Terminal) - 3000 Won (Every hour and a half) This bus also stops at Jindong (2200 won) where it's possible to connect to destinations such as Tongyeong and Jinju.
